About Emad A. Soliman

Emad A. Soliman is a scholar working on Biomaterials, Surfaces, Coatings and Films and Molecular Medicine, having authored 46 papers that have together received 1.1k indexed citations. Recurring topics across this work include Nanocomposite Films for Food Packaging (9 papers), Electrospun Nanofibers in Biomedical Applications (5 papers) and Fuel Cells and Related Materials (4 papers). The work is most often cited by research in Biomaterials (383 citations), Molecular Medicine (97 citations) and Analytical Chemistry (128 citations). Emad A. Soliman has collaborated with scholars based in Egypt, Saudi Arabia and Japan. Frequent co-authors include M.S. Mohy Eldin, M.A. Abu-Saied, Masakazu Furuta, Ahmed Y. El-Moghazy, Ahmed A. Elzatahry, E. A. Hassan, Marwa R. Elkatory, Ahmed M. Omer, Ahmed I. Hashem and Tamer M. Tamer. Their work appears in journals such as Journal of Agricultural and Food Chemistry, Scientific Reports and Food Chemistry.
